Parietal Lobe
A region of the brain located behind the frontal lobe, responsible for processing sensory information regarding the location of parts of the body as well as visual information.
Cerebral Hemispheres
The two halves of the brain, each of which controls different functions. The right hemisphere is associated with creative and holistic thought processes, while the left hemisphere is associated with analytic and logical reasoning.
Cerebellums
The plural form of cerebellum, referring to the part of the brain at the back of the skull, which is responsible for coordinating voluntary movements.
Corpus Callosums
A broad band of nerve fibers joining the two hemispheres of the brain, facilitating communication between them.
